How much do master electronics engineer jobs pay per year?

As of Sep 10, 2026, the average yearly pay for master electronics engineer in the United States is $88,896.00, according to ZipRecruiter salary data. Most workers in this role earn between $59,500.00 and $109,500.00 per year, depending on experience, location, and employer.

What is a master electronics engineer?

Master Electronics Engineers are highly experienced professionals who design, develop, and oversee complex electronic systems and components. They often lead teams of engineers, troubleshoot advanced technical issues, and ensure that projects meet quality and safety standards. Their expertise spans areas such as circuit design, embedded systems, signal processing, and electronics manufacturing. Typically, they hold advanced degrees and have significant industry experience, making them leaders in the field of electronics engineering.

What are the key skills and qualifications needed to thrive as a master electronics engineer?

To thrive as a Master Electronics Engineer, you need advanced expertise in circuit design, systems integration, and electronic theory, typically supported by a bachelor's or master's degree in electrical or electronics engineering. Familiarity with industry-standard tools like MATLAB, SPICE, PCB design software (e.g., Altium Designer), and relevant certifications such as Professional Engineer (PE) can be crucial. Strong analytical thinking, problem-solving abilities, and effective communication skills help you collaborate on complex projects and lead engineering teams. These competencies are vital for developing innovative electronic solutions, ensuring reliability, and driving successful project outcomes.

What are some common challenges faced by master electronics engineers when leading complex projects?

Master Electronics Engineers often face the challenge of balancing technical oversight with project management responsibilities. They must coordinate cross-functional teams, ensure that design specifications meet both regulatory standards and client needs, and manage tight deadlines. Additionally, they are expected to troubleshoot advanced technical issues and mentor junior engineers, which requires strong communication and leadership skills. Successfully managing these demands is key to driving project success and fostering innovation within the team.

Job Description
We are seeking an Electronics Engineer to support our work with the U.S. Army Research Laboratory (ARL) in Adelphi, MD. The Electronics Engineer will design, develop, and test RF and/or microwave systems architecture, components, and products. You will apply engineering theories and research techniques in the investigation and solution of highly complex and advanced technical problems on the forefront of new and existing Electronic Warfare (EW) technologies and Software Defined Radio (SDR) sensor systems. You will plan, conduct, and direct projects and coordinate the efforts of technical support staff in the performance of radar, communication systems, and phased array system designs. The RF Engineer works directly with senior technical personnel, program managers, and external organizations in the planning, oversight, execution, and evaluation of multiple complex RF systems.

Essential Job Responsibilities
  • Apply advanced signal processing concepts to problems in RF systems, radar sensing, and communications.
  • Analyze, model, and interpret complex waveforms and sensor data, including developing or adapting algorithms for detection, estimation, classification, and interference mitigation.
  • Support research efforts in areas such as adaptive filtering, spectral analysis, time-frequency methods, compressive sensing, and statistical signal processing.
  • Conduct exploratory R&D alongside researchers in physics, mathematics, and related science disciplines.
  • Participate in designing and evaluating RF system architectures including receivers, transmitters, antennas, and novel sensing modalities.
  • Assist with algorithm prototyping in software environments such as MATLAB, Python, or C/C++, and evaluate performance with laboratory RF equipment.
  • Work closely with multi-disciplinary teams on radar, EW, and next-generation communications concepts.
  • Prepare technical reports, presentations, and data packages to document methodology, results, and recommendations.
